What is a "fin"?

A fin on a vehicle is a protruding feature often seen on the body of a car, particularly on older models or sports cars. It is designed to improve aerodynamics by reducing air resistance and increasing stability at higher speeds. Fins can also be purely decorative, adding a distinctive look to the vehicle. They are typically found along the rear end of the car, on the sides or back, and were more common in the mid-20th century, especially in the designs of American cars.
